文件:

  1. silverlightLogoLoop.wmv
  2. SilverlightLogo.xml
  3. Silverlight.js
  4. demo.html

SilverlightLogo.xml

<Canvas 
   xmlns="http://schemas.microsoft.com/client/2007"
   x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
        Cursor="Hand" MouseLeftButtonDown="_LogoLinkDown">   <MediaElement x:Name="media" Loaded="root_LogoLoaded" Source="silverlightLogoLoop.wmv" Canvas.Left="20" Canvas.Top="0" Height="110" Width="110" > 
      <MediaElement.Clip>
         <EllipseGeometry Center="55,55" RadiusX="53" RadiusY="53" />
      </MediaElement.Clip>
   </MediaElement>
</Canvas>

Demo.html

<script src="Silverlight.js" type="text/javascript"></script>
<script language='javascript' type='text/javascript' >
function root_LogoLoaded(sender, args) {
    var media = sender.findName("media");
    media.addEventListener("mediaEnded", "LogohandleCompleted");
} function LogohandleCompleted(sender, eventArgs) {
    sender.stop();
    sender.play();
} function _LogoLinkDown(sender, args){
   window.location="http://silverlight.net/default.aspx";
}
</script>
<div id="agLogoHost">logo</div>
<script type="text/javascript">                                            
            var peLogo = document.getElementById("agLogoHost");
Silverlight.createObjectEx({source: 'SilverlightLogo.xml', parentElement:peLogo, id:'AgLogoControl', properties: {width:'143', height:'159', background:'#00000000', isWindowless:'true', framerate:'24', version:'1.0.0'}, events: {onError:null, onLoad:null}, context:null});
        </script>

ps:我blog右侧就用的是这个  :-)      源文件下载

silverlightLogo动画相关推荐

  1. Android Animation (安卓动画)概念简介

    Android Animation Android 四种动画分别为逐帧动画和补间动画.属性动画.过渡动画: Frame Animation (逐帧动画) 实现方式:xml 和 Java代码 图片跳转的 ...

  2. Android动画之帧动画和补间动画

    Android系统提供三种动画:帧动画.补间动画和属性动画.这里先分析总结帧动画和补间动画. FrameAnimation 帧动画,通俗来说就是按照图片动作顺序依次播放来形成动画,创建帧动画可以用 x ...

  3. Android 动画 ViewPropertyAnimator 的使用

    ViewPropertyAnimator 说明: ViewPropertyAnimator 可为View对象上的选择属性启用自动和优化的动画, ViewPropertyAnimator 不是由调用方构 ...

  4. Android ViewAnimationUtils (动画) 的使用

    先看下ViewAnimationUtils  实现的几个常见的效果图如下: ViewAnimationUtils  的作用: 设置剪切圆动画的动画制作器 一般的使用如下: Animator revea ...

  5. Android AnimationUtils (动画)的使用

    AnimationUtils  其实就是补间动画(Tween Animation) 在xml 中的写了动画java 中调用 这边打算就写一个demo 简答的记录下它的使用详细的请看 点击查看,这篇博客 ...

  6. Android ProgressBar 加载中界面实现(loading 动画) 实现菊花的效果

    实现的效果图如下: 使用方法ProgressBar ,如果感觉 这个动画不是自己想要的,需要根据ui的图片来实现只需要将xml中的animated-rotate 修改为animation-list 贴 ...

  7. Android 属性动画(Property Animation) ObjectAnimator的介绍

    先说下属性动画与视图动画的区别: 视图动画系统仅提供为 View 对象添加动画效果的功能,因此,如果您想为非 对象添加动画效果,则必须实现自己的代码才能做到.视图动画系统也存在一些限制,因为它仅公开 ...

  8. Android 属性动画(Property Animation) ValueAnimator 的介绍

    先说下属性动画与视图动画的区别: 视图动画系统仅提供为 View 对象添加动画效果的功能,因此,如果您想为非 对象添加动画效果,则必须实现自己的代码才能做到.视图动画系统也存在一些限制,因为它仅公开 ...

  9. Android 补间动画(Tween Animation)

    Tween Animation(补间动画): Tween动画,通过对View的内容进行一系列的图形变换 (包括平移.缩放.旋转.改变透明度)来实现动画效果.动画效果的定义可以采用XML来做也可以采用编 ...

最新文章

  1. SpiderData 2019年2月12日 DApp数据排行榜
  2. 计算机软件基础02243知识点,02243计算机软件基础(一) 历年真题
  3. ITK:从文件读取转换
  4. JavaScript闭包的底层运行机制
  5. 新发现一款监控Linux集群sinfo
  6. 公用ip地址查询_是什么使您无法更改公用IP地址并在Internet上造成严重破坏?
  7. 钢笔墨水能否代替打印机墨水_LAMY钢笔应该如何选择墨水?
  8. QT中IDirect3DDevice9的Present方法失败情况的处理笔记
  9. shell获取路径文件的文件名
  10. “霸座女”越席乘坐火车并阻碍民警执行职务被拘留
  11. 【英语学习】【WOTD】cacophony 释义/词源/示例
  12. GlusterFS分布式存储系统
  13. python教程-Python快速教程
  14. html5 手机上传视频,【报Bug】手机h5端收不到选择视频以及上传视频回调
  15. python运行cmd命令和opencv搭建_Python环境搭建之OpenCV
  16. 电脑usb蓝牙的使用
  17. 用git下载github项目失败werning : Clone succeeded, but checkout failed.
  18. 服务器游戏性能测试工具,python 游戏服务器 性能测试工具
  19. linux cgroup 学习的一些总结
  20. 计算机专业硕士论文字数要求,计算机专业硕士论文写作格式要求(参考)

热门文章

  1. 酱茄企业官网多端开源小程序源码 v1.0.0
  2. GTK的.NET的函数库 GTK#
  3. 你要了解的11款面向Linux系统的一流备份实用工具
  4. 比较两种php调用Java对象的方法
  5. Python——为什么要在意:模块重载
  6. LeetCode 287. Find the Duplicate Number
  7. 【MarkDown】转义字符
  8. 【C++基础学习】关于C++静态成员函数和变量
  9. 演练 望炉山瀑布文字样式 0929
  10. 排序算法 快速排序 python 0913